U.S. credit card volumes grew nicely in 2Q, and 2018 will likely be a banner year for credit card transactions.

This article in Forbes expects to see a shift between the second largest  network and the third, Mastercard and American Expresss, respectively.

Visa delivered $493 billion in transaction volume for 2Q2018, representing a 10.5% increase over 2017.  Mastercard volume hit $202 billion, with an 8% increase.  American Express grew by 10% during the same period, bringing in $195 billion in spend.   Discover carried only $36 billion of the total $927 billion; their growth was 9.0%.

Though American Express and Mastercard are neck-and-neck for the second ranked position, Amex reduced the gap from $9 billion to $7 billion.

The positioning shift will likely happen in 1Q19.  A billion dollars in transaction volume will not make much of a shareholder impact, but for American Express, the move will be “Priceless.”
